🏛️ A Brief History of Atlantic International University

Founded by Dr. Ed Long in 1999, AIU pioneered distance education from its base in Honolulu. What began as a small operation offering flexible degrees has expanded to over 30,000 alumni across 180 countries. The university's philosophy centers on life experience equating to classroom learning, a concept known as prior learning assessment (PLA). This approach influences its job market, favoring candidates with real-world expertise over conventional paths.

Key milestones include accreditation recognition by bodies like the Accreditation Service for International Schools, Colleges, and Universities (ASIC), and a shift toward fully online delivery post-2000s digital boom. Today, AIU's Honolulu headquarters oversees operations, blending island culture with international academia. 📖 Definitions

To fully grasp jobs at Atlantic International University, key terms include:

  • Distance Education: A learning format where instruction occurs remotely via internet, without physical classes—core to AIU's model.
  • Adjunct Faculty: Part-time instructors hired per course, common in online universities for flexibility.
  • Prior Learning Assessment (PLA): Evaluation of work/life experience for academic credit, a hallmark of AIU programs.
  • Learning Management System (LMS): Software like Canvas or Blackboard for course delivery and interaction.
